Kubernetes Mac Works NativelyKubernetes also has advanced load balancing capabilities for web traffic routing to web servers in operations.Kubernetes architecture and how it works?Kubernetes evolved from the code that Google used to manage its data centers at scale with the “Borg” platform. Kubernetes scales up web servers according to the demand for the software applications, then degrades web server instances during downtimes. Web server hardware can be located in different data centers, on different hardware, or through different hosting providers. Get the Paper Kubernetes featuresKubernetes features the ability to automate web server provisioning according to the level of web traffic in production. Container virtualization is different than VM or VPS tools using hypervisors and generally requires a smaller operating system footprint in production.The main advantage of Kubernetes is the ability to operate an automated, elastic web server platform in production without the vendor lock-in to AWS with the EC2 service. RancherOS, CoreOS, and Alpine Linux are popular operating systems specifically designed for container usage. Docker is a software development company that specializes in container virtualization, whereas Kubernetes is an open-source project supported by a community of coders that includes professional programmers from all of the major IT companies. Docker has the largest share of the container virtualization marketplace for software products. Intel also has a competing container standard with Kata, and there are several Linux container versions.
